I have been thinking of this for some time as I watch with alarm the steady rise of fuel prices. I haven't checked today, but yesterday fuel at the cheaper stations was $2.84/gallon. I haven't a clue how much it is out west. I was in Santa Fe in 1999 and it was $1.15 and I thought that was high.

My journey is to begin at Birmimngham, AL and end 4500 miles later at Anchorage, Alaska. Round trip is 9,000 miles, and that doesn't include the touring for the summer in the state, prol'ly another 2500 miles. Prices are bad enough in the US and are getting worse, but in Western Canada, and then up that Alaska highway in Canada it's going to be horrific. Fuel in those remote places along the highway has to be hauled in by truck. From Dawson Creek, the beginning of the Alaska Highway to Tok, AK, the end of the Alaska Highway, 1450-1500 miles, all fuel along the way gets there by truck.

Anyone got any connections to Dawson Creek, Ft. Nelson, Muncho Lake area, Watson Lake, and Whitehorse? All places for fuel going up the highway? I would like to see fuel pries in those places.

It is possible for this fuel price thing to completely kill off my long planned trip up north. Fuel cost could go beyond my means.
